Trademark Summary

The trademark application ONE TRUE SINGER was filed by HBO ROMANIA SRL, a corporation established under the laws of Romania (the "Applicant"). The application was published for oppositions on September 2, 2021, and it was registered by office on December 10, 2021 without any oppositions.

The application was filed in English (Spanish was selected as the second language).
